Front yard leveling services involve assessing and correcting uneven or sloped ground in residential outdoor spaces. Skilled contractors typically use specialized equipment to identify areas where the soil has shifted or settled over time. They then carefully regrade the landscape to create a smooth, even surface that improves the appearance and functionality of the yard. This process often includes adding or removing soil as needed to achieve a consistent slope, which can help prevent future problems and prepare the yard for additional landscaping or features.

Uneven yards can lead to several issues for homeowners. Water runoff may become problematic, causing pooling or erosion that can damage foundations or create muddy areas. Additionally, uneven ground can pose safety hazards, increasing the risk of trips and falls. Over time, poor grading can also affect the health of grass and plants by causing poor drainage or soil compaction. Front yard leveling services help address these problems by creating a stable, properly sloped surface that directs water away from the home and provides a safer, more attractive outdoor space.

The overview below groups typical Front Yard Leveling proj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Seattle, WA.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typically, minor leveling projects for small sections of a yard cost between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, especially for addressing localized unevenness or minor erosion issues.

Moderate Leveling - Medium-sized yard leveling projects usually range from $600 to $1,500. These projects often involve larger areas or moderate grading work handled by local contractors in Seattle and nearby areas.

Extensive Resurfacing - Larger, more complex projects such as significant slope corrections or extensive yard overhauls can range from $1,500 to $3,500. Fewer projects reach this tier, but they are common for properties requiring comprehensive leveling.

Full Yard Replacement - Complete yard leveling or replacement projects can exceed $3,500 and may reach $5,000 or more depending on the size and scope. These are typically reserved for large properties or highly detailed work requiring substantial excavation and grading by experienced local pros.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is front yard leveling? Front yard leveling involves adjusting the slope and surface of the yard to create a more even and functional outdoor space, helping with drainage and appearance.

Why should I consider front yard leveling? Leveling can prevent water pooling, improve curb appeal, and prepare the yard for landscaping or other outdoor projects.

What types of materials are used for front yard leveling? Contractors typically use soil, gravel, or other fill materials to achieve the desired level surface based on the yard’s needs.

How do local service providers handle uneven terrain? They assess the yard’s condition and use appropriate grading techniques and materials to create a smooth, stable surface.

What factors influence the approach to front yard leveling? The existing landscape, soil type, drainage patterns, and desired final grade all help determine the best method for leveling the yard.
